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8405559772 880 9213427412
31 906
31 906
04 953353 67 44547210 9379100973
All about undefined
Interested in learning more?
31 906
04 953353 67 44547210 9379100973
See more
818738 17602390209
03 06090927750 139 7445871474
See more
63 432160470 311374615
55026 1314 6577318
See more